Starting, Friday, January 31, our Spring 2025 students will be participating in a series of Welcome Week activities. On Friday, they will enjoy a lovely walking tour through the Maria Luisa Park, the Plaza de España, the University of Seville, and the Center of the Old Town of Seville. The activities will continue throughout the weekend and will include a visit to the Museo del Baile Flamenco where they will see a once in a lifetime dance performance and an magical river cruise along Seville’s Guadalquivir River. Welcome Week will culminate with a Post-Arrival Student support session, where students will have a chance to discuss their goals for the semester and develop actionable ways to avoid culture shock to make the most of their experience in Seville.
